## Break-glass: Replica lag alarm (Fernvale DB)

When the read-replica lag alarm on the Fernvale cluster exceeds the hard threshold and the primary on-call cannot be reached, break-glass access may be used. Reviewers approving the emergency change must verify the lag metric screenshot is attached and that writes were not redirected. Unlock the break-glass credential store with the recovery passphrase below.

unlock words, hahip-yagef: zorok-novmir-zorix-silax

# Runbook: Hunting leaked file descriptors in Quillgate

When the `fd_open` gauge climbs steadily between deploys, suspect a leak rather than load. First confirm on a single pod: exec in and count entries under `/proc/1/fd`, noting how many are sockets in CLOSE_WAIT versus regular files. Capture two snapshots ten minutes apart before restarting anything — we need the delta for the postmortem. Reproduce locally with the Marbury load harness, which requires the service running with the following configuration values.

settings of yagep-bajog:
[istdor]
port = 4000
region = south-2
host = istdor.qorvelcorp.internal
timeout_ms = 5000
retries = 5

- [ ] **Step 7: Breaker override escrow.** After sealing the signing keys for the Tallgrove upstream API circuit breaker, confirm the support team can force the breaker open during a full outage. The override bundle lives in the sealed escrow drawer and is useless without its unlock phrase. Two ceremony witnesses must initial this step before proceeding. The escrow bundle is decrypted with the recovery passphrase that follows.

vault phrase of kahip-kahop = holath-quenmir